Youngsters at Culford School are celebrating after their school received two glowing inspection reports.
Inspectors from Ofsted rated the school's boarding care as 'outstanding' following their latest visit, while its prep, pre-prep and senior schools all had excellent feedback from the Independent Schools Inspectorate (ISI).

According to an ISI report published last month following an inspection in November, teaching in all sections of the school was good and in many cases outstanding, while its pastoral care also came in for praise.

Inspectors said the school was already aware of its weaknesses, which included a need to develop the senior school's library and a need for the prep and pre-prep schools to give appropriate work to children at all levels.

Meanwhile, Ofsted inspectors who visited the boarding school at the same time said boarders were 'provided with a high level of care and outstanding pastoral support', while security and pupils' meal choices had improved since their last visit.

Headteacher Julian Johnson-Munday called the reports 'a fantastic endorsement', adding: "The reports have given us real pride and we all look forward to building even further upon this success."
